summaryrefslogtreecommitdiff
path: root/docs/reference/pygtk-gtktextattributes.xml
diff options
context:
space:
mode:
Diffstat (limited to 'docs/reference/pygtk-gtktextattributes.xml')
-rw-r--r--docs/reference/pygtk-gtktextattributes.xml353
1 files changed, 0 insertions, 353 deletions
diff --git a/docs/reference/pygtk-gtktextattributes.xml b/docs/reference/pygtk-gtktextattributes.xml
deleted file mode 100644
index 89b1fbd4..00000000
--- a/docs/reference/pygtk-gtktextattributes.xml
+++ /dev/null
@@ -1,353 +0,0 @@
-<?xml version="1.0" standalone="no"?>
-<!DOCTYPE refentry PUBLIC "-//OASIS//DTD DocBook XML V4.1.2//EN"
- "http://www.oasis-open.org/docbook/xml/4.1.2/docbookx.dtd">
-
-<refentry id="class-gtktextattributes">
- <refnamediv>
- <refname>gtk.TextAttributes</refname>
- <refpurpose>an object containing the attributes set on some
-text</refpurpose>
- </refnamediv>
-
- <refsect1>
- <title>Synopsis</title>
-
- <classsynopsis language="python">
- <ooclass><classname>gtk.TextAttributes</classname></ooclass>
- <ooclass><classname>gobject.GBoxed</classname></ooclass>
- <constructorsynopsis language="python">
- <methodname><link
-linkend="constructor-gtktextattributes">gtk.TextAttributes</link></methodname>
- <methodparam></methodparam> </constructorsynopsis>
- <methodsynopsis language="python">
- <methodname><link
-linkend="method-gtktextattributes--copy">copy</link></methodname>
- <methodparam></methodparam> </methodsynopsis>
- <methodsynopsis language="python">
- <methodname><link
-linkend="method-gtktextattributes--copy-values">copy_values</link></methodname>
- <methodparam><parameter role="keyword">dest</parameter></methodparam>
- </methodsynopsis>
- </classsynopsis>
-
- </refsect1>
-
- <refsect1>
- <title>Attributes</title>
-
- <blockquote role="properties">
- <informaltable pgwide="1" frame="none">
- <tgroup cols="3">
- <?dbhtml cellpadding="5"?>
- <colspec column="1" colwidth="1in"/>
- <colspec column="2" colwidth="1in"/>
- <colspec column="3" colwidth="4in"/>
- <tbody>
-
- <row valign="top">
- <entry>"bg_color"</entry>
- <entry>Read</entry>
- <entry>The background color</entry>
- </row>
-
- <row valign="top">
- <entry>"fg_color"</entry>
- <entry>Read</entry>
- <entry>The foreground color</entry>
- </row>
-
- <row valign="top">
- <entry>"bg_stipple"</entry>
- <entry>Read</entry>
- <entry>The background stipple bitmap</entry>
- </row>
-
- <row valign="top">
- <entry>"fg_stipple"</entry>
- <entry>Read</entry>
- <entry>The foreground stipple bitmap</entry>
- </row>
-
- <row valign="top">
- <entry>"rise"</entry>
- <entry>Read</entry>
- <entry>The subscript or superscript rise</entry>
- </row>
-
- <row valign="top">
- <entry>"underline"</entry>
- <entry>Read</entry>
- <entry>The style of underline - one of:
-<literal>pango.UNDERLINE_NONE</literal>,
-<literal>pango.UNDERLINE_SINGLE</literal>,
-<literal>pango.UNDERLINE_DOUBLE</literal>,
-<literal>pango.UNDERLINE_LOW</literal></entry>
- </row>
-
- <row valign="top">
- <entry>"strikethrough"</entry>
- <entry>Read</entry>
- <entry>If <literal>True</literal> strikethrough the text</entry>
- </row>
-
- <row valign="top">
- <entry>"draw_bg"</entry>
- <entry>Read</entry>
- <entry>If <literal>True</literal> some background attributes
-are set</entry>
- </row>
-
- <row valign="top">
- <entry>"justification"</entry>
- <entry>Read</entry>
- <entry>The type of justification - one of:
-<literal>gtk.JUSTIFY_LEFT</literal>, <literal>gtk.JUSTIFY_RIGHT</literal>,
-<literal>gtk.JUSTIFY_CENTER</literal>,
-<literal>gtk.JUSTIFY_FILL</literal></entry>
- </row>
-
- <row valign="top">
- <entry>"direction"</entry>
- <entry>Read</entry>
- <entry>The text direction - one of:
-<literal>gtk.TEXT_DIR_NONE</literal>, <literal>gtk.TEXT_DIR_LTR</literal>,
-<literal>gtk.TEXT_DIR_RTL</literal></entry>
- </row>
-
- <row valign="top">
- <entry>"font"</entry>
- <entry>Read</entry>
- <entry>A <classname>pango.FontDescription</classname></entry>
- </row>
-
- <row valign="top">
- <entry>"font_scale"</entry>
- <entry>Read</entry>
- <entry>The scale of the font e.g. 2.5</entry>
- </row>
-
- <row valign="top">
- <entry>"left_margin"</entry>
- <entry>Read</entry>
- <entry>The width of the left margin in pixels</entry>
- </row>
-
- <row valign="top">
- <entry>"indent"</entry>
- <entry>Read</entry>
- <entry>The width of the paragraph indent in pixels</entry>
- </row>
-
- <row valign="top">
- <entry>"right_margin"</entry>
- <entry>Read</entry>
- <entry>The width of the right margin</entry>
- </row>
-
- <row valign="top">
- <entry>"pixels_above_lines"</entry>
- <entry>Read</entry>
- <entry>The number of pixels space above a paragraph</entry>
- </row>
-
- <row valign="top">
- <entry>"pixels_below_lines"</entry>
- <entry>Read</entry>
- <entry>The number of pixels space below a paragraph</entry>
- </row>
-
- <row valign="top">
- <entry>"pixels_inside_wrap"</entry>
- <entry>Read</entry>
- <entry>The number of pixels of space between wrapped lines in
-a paragraph</entry>
- </row>
-
- <row valign="top">
- <entry>"tabs"</entry>
- <entry>Read</entry>
- <entry>A set of tabs contained in a
-<classname>pango.TabArray</classname></entry>
- </row>
-
- <row valign="top">
- <entry>"wrap_mode"</entry>
- <entry>Read</entry>
- <entry>The wrap mode - one of: <literal>gtk.WRAP_NONE</literal>,
- <literal>gtk.WRAP_CHAR</literal>,
- <literal>gtk.WRAP_WORD</literal></entry>
- </row>
-
- <row valign="top">
- <entry>"language"</entry>
- <entry>Read</entry>
- <entry>The <classname>pango.Language</classname> object
-describing the text language</entry>
- </row>
-
- <row valign="top">
- <entry>"invisible"</entry>
- <entry>Read</entry>
- <entry>If <literal>True</literal> the text is hidden (Not
-implemented in PyGTK2)</entry>
- </row>
-
- <row valign="top">
- <entry>"bg_full_height"</entry>
- <entry>Read</entry>
- <entry>If <literal>True</literal> the background is fit to the
-full line height</entry>
- </row>
-
- <row valign="top">
- <entry>"editable"</entry>
- <entry>Read</entry>
- <entry>If <literal>True</literal> the text is editable</entry>
- </row>
-
- <row valign="top">
- <entry>"realized"</entry>
- <entry>Read</entry>
- <entry>If <literal>True</literal> the text has been
-realized</entry>
- </row>
-
- <row valign="top">
- <entry>"pad1"</entry>
- <entry>Read</entry>
- <entry></entry>
- </row>
-
- <row valign="top">
- <entry>"pad2"</entry>
- <entry>Read</entry>
- <entry></entry>
- </row>
-
- <row valign="top">
- <entry>"pad3"</entry>
- <entry>Read</entry>
- <entry></entry>
- </row>
-
- <row valign="top">
- <entry>"pad4"</entry>
- <entry>Read</entry>
- <entry></entry>
- </row>
-
- </tbody>
- </tgroup>
- </informaltable>
- </blockquote>
-
- </refsect1>
-
- <refsect1>
- <title>Description</title>
-
- <para>A <link
-linkend="class-gtktextattributes"><classname>gtk.TextAttributes</classname></link>
-object holds a set of attributes that describe the properties of a section
-of text. A <link
-linkend="class-gtktextattributes"><classname>gtk.TextAttributes</classname></link>
-object is usually obtained by calling either of the <link
-linkend="method-gtktextiter--get-attributes"><methodname>gtk.TextIter.get_attributes</methodname>()</link>
-or <link
-linkend="method-gtktextview--get-default-attributes"><methodname>gtk.TextView.get_default_attributes</methodname>()</link>
-methods to retrieve the attributes in effect.</para>
-
- <para>A <link
-linkend="class-gtktextattributes"><classname>gtk.TextAttributes</classname></link>
-object created with <link
-linkend="constructor-gtktextattributes">gtk.TextAttributes</link>() cannot
-be applied within PyGTK because there is no way to set the attributes.
-Likewise, the <link
-linkend="method-gtktextattributes--copy"><methodname>copy</methodname>()</link>
-and <link
-linkend="method-gtktextattributes--copy-values"><methodname>copy_values</methodname>()</link>
-methods can create a new copy or copy the attributes but there are no
-methods in PyGTK that take a <link
-linkend="class-gtktextattributes"><classname>gtk.TextAttributes</classname></link>
-object as an argument. The most effective way to use a <link
-linkend="class-gtktextattributes"><classname>gtk.TextAttributes</classname></link>
-object is to read its attributes and use them to set the properties of a
-<link
-linkend="class-gtktexttag"><classname>gtk.TextTag</classname></link>.</para>
-
- </refsect1>
-
- <refsect1 id="constructor-gtktextattributes">
- <title>Constructor</title>
-
- <programlisting><constructorsynopsis language="python">
- <methodname>gtk.TextAttributes</methodname>
- <methodparam></methodparam> </constructorsynopsis></programlisting>
- <variablelist>
- <varlistentry>
- <term><emphasis>Returns</emphasis>&nbsp;:</term>
- <listitem><simpara>a new <link
-linkend="class-gtktextattributes"><classname>gtk.TextAttributes</classname></link></simpara></listitem>
- </varlistentry>
- </variablelist>
-
- <para>Creates a <link
-linkend="class-gtktextattributes"><classname>gtk.TextAttributes</classname></link>
-object, that contains a set of attributes of some text.</para>
-
- </refsect1>
-
- <refsect1>
- <title>Methods</title>
-
- <refsect2 id="method-gtktextattributes--copy">
- <title>gtk.TextAttributes.copy</title>
-
- <programlisting><methodsynopsis language="python">
- <methodname>copy</methodname>
- <methodparam></methodparam> </methodsynopsis></programlisting>
- <variablelist>
- <varlistentry>
- <term><emphasis>Returns</emphasis>&nbsp;:</term>
- <listitem><simpara>a copy of the <link
-linkend="class-gtktextattributes"><classname>gtk.TextAttributes</classname></link>
-object</simpara></listitem>
- </varlistentry>
- </variablelist>
-
- <para>The <methodname>copy</methodname>() method copies the text
-attributes and returns a new <link
-linkend="class-gtktextattributes"><classname>gtk.TextAttributes</classname></link>
-object.</para>
-
- </refsect2>
-
- <refsect2 id="method-gtktextattributes--copy-values">
- <title>gtk.TextAttributes.copy_values</title>
-
- <programlisting><methodsynopsis language="python">
- <methodname>copy_values</methodname>
- <methodparam><parameter
- role="keyword">dest</parameter></methodparam>
- </methodsynopsis></programlisting>
- <variablelist>
- <varlistentry>
- <term><parameter role="keyword">dest</parameter>&nbsp;:</term>
- <listitem><simpara>the <link
-linkend="class-gtktextattributes"><classname>gtk.TextAttributes</classname></link>
-whose attributes will be set</simpara></listitem>
- </varlistentry>
- </variablelist>
-
- <para>The <methodname>copy_values</methodname>() method copies the
-values from the <link
-linkend="class-gtktextattributes"><classname>gtk.TextAttributes</classname></link>
-object to <parameter>dest</parameter> so that <parameter>dest</parameter>
-has the same values. Frees existing values in
-<parameter>dest</parameter>.</para>
-
- </refsect2>
-
- </refsect1>
-
-</refentry>